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ple, Real Openers That Work

If sending the first message feels awkward, keep one simple rule in mind: be curious, not performative. A short, specific opener that references the other person’s profile or gives a clear next step beats a vague “hey” or a generic compliment every time.

Quick opener patterns you can adapt

  • Profile hook + light question: “I see you love road trips — what’s the most unexpectedly great stop you’ve made?”
  • Choice prompt (low-pressure): “Coffee or tea when you’re off work? I’m testing opinions.”
  • Observation + callback: “You have a photo at a farmers’ market — did you score anything surprising that day?”
  • Micro-challenge: “Two truths and a tiny lie: I’ve hiked a volcano, I once met a musician backstage, I can juggle. Which is the lie?”
  • Shared interest opener: “You mentioned indie films — any recent watch you’d recommend for someone who likes character-driven stories?”

How to make these feel natural

  1. Scan for specifics. Use a detail from their bio or photos instead of commenting on looks.
  2. Keep it short. One to three lines invites reply without pressure.
  3. Use an open-ended question that’s easy to answer. Avoid yes/no traps unless you add a follow-up.
  4. Match tone. If their profile is playful, mirror that; if it’s direct, be direct.

Avoid these common pitfalls

  • Generic flattery: “You’re gorgeous” has no hook. Tie a compliment to something concrete if you use one.
  • Overly intense questions: Don’t lead with “What are you looking for?” on the first message.
  • Copy-paste openers: If your message could be sent to anyone, it probably will be ignored.
